Two Reservoirs and a Stream
On-site, we have two reservoirs and a nearby stream. Together, these vital resources provide the water our roses need. Our water capture and recycling system collects 60 to 80% of the rainwater and excess irrigation water that falls on our nursery, and in total supplies over 90% of the water we use each year.
The combined capacity of our two reservoirs and the stream is an impressive 126,000 cubic metres of water, equivalent to filling about 50 Olympic-sized swimming pools.
How We Recycle Water
Our water recycling process is simple: we collect rainwater from our buildings, along with surplus irrigation water used for our roses. After filtering and treating, we store it in our two reservoirs for reuse.
To ensure high water quality, we test pH levels weekly and check for harmful pathogens. Because of the size of our main reservoir, we even use a dinghy to collect water samples.
When it's time to water our roses, the water flows from the top reservoir through a siphon to a holding tank. From there, it is gravity-fed back to our roses, ensuring efficient use of every drop. We also use a copper dosing machine to treat the water, effectively removing harmful spores that could affect our roses.
Once treated, the water is distributed throughout our nursery to keep our plants healthy.
